OHP: 1 Dead, 1 Taken To Hospital After Helicopter Crash In Noble County

Beverly Cantrell - November 29, 2021 11:39 am

PERRY, Oklahoma – 

The Oklahoma Highway Patrol (OHP) confirmed that one person died and another person was flown to the hospital after a helicopter crashed in Noble County Sunday afternoon.

Authorities said the aircraft was a privately owned full-size helicopter with only two people on board.

The OHP said the crash occurred west of I-35 near N. 3180 Road and Old John Deere in Perry, Oklahoma, but are unsure of what caused the crash at this time.

The OHP said the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) is investigating the crash.
